India Ladies continued their dominant run within the 5‑match T20I sequence in opposition to Sri Lanka with a 30‑run victory within the India vs Sri Lanka Ladies 4th T20I on the Greenfield Worldwide Stadium in Thiruvananthapuram on 28 December 2025.
Openers Smriti Mandhana and Shafali Verma produced a blistering 162‑run opening stand, propelling India to 221/2, their highest ever Ladies’s T20I complete and a file partnership for any wicket by an Indian pair that’s now celebrated as a Ladies’s T20I world file.
Mandhana’s 80 off 48 balls not solely arrange the sport but additionally underscored the Smriti Mandhana world file for the quickest participant in ladies’s cricket historical past to succeed in 10,000 worldwide runs; she achieved the milestone in her 280th look, overtaking legends Mithali Raj, Suzie Bates and Charlotte Edwards.
On this India Ladies vs Sri Lanka Ladies encounter, Sri Lanka fought bravely via Chamari Athapaththu’s 52 and Hasini Perera’s 33 however had been restricted to 191/6, handing India a 4‑0 sequence lead.
Match Overview – How The Motion Unfolded
India was invited to bat, as they received the toss. Mandhana and Verma had been cautious of their preliminary opening, after which they poured down the boundaries.
The 2 additionally sprinted to 61/0 within the energy play, they usually punished any quick or full pitch.
Document partnership
The fitting-left pair contributed 162 runs in 15.2 overs, which is a file of 143 in opposition to the West Indies in 2019. Flamboyant 79 off 46 balls by Verma had 12 fours and a six; Mandhana hit 11 fours and three sixes.
Mandhana described their method merely: “We simply inform one another to observe the ball…likewise, we needed to maintain Shafali on strike as she needed to hit each ball for six.”
After each openers fell in successive overs, Richa Ghosh (40* off 16 balls) and captain Harmanpreet Kaur (16* off 9) added an unbroken 53‑run stand to push India previous 220.
Sri Lanka’s chase
Hasini Perera (33 off 20) and Chamari Athapaththu (52 off 37) had been the openers who strangled 50 within the first 4 overs, and this gave Sri Lanka an early lead. There have been three fours, three sixes within the knock of Athapaththu.
Imesha Dulani (29), Harshitha Samarawickrama (20) and Nilakshika Silva (23*) stored the chase alive, however India’s bowlers utilized strain via left‑arm spinner Vaishnavi Sharma’s 2/24 and seamer Arundhati Reddy’s 2/42. Sri Lanka completed on 191/6, their highest T20I rating.

India vs Sri Lanka Ladies 4th T20I Bowling highlights:
Vaishnavi Sharma had 4‑0‑24‑2; managed the center overs and dismissed Athapaththu and Samarawickrama. Arundhati Reddy: 4‑0‑42‑2; eliminated Perera and Kavisha Dilhari.
The bowlers of Sri Lanka had been overwhelmed by the onslaught of India: the one two wicket takers had been Malsha Shehani and Nimasha Meepage, who gave 1/32 and 1/40 respectively.
Data & milestones
This was a 221/2 that was greater than their greatest in opposition to West Indies 217/4 in 2024.
Document partnership
The 162-run partnership between Mandhana and Verma is the very best level between India Ladies in T20Is and surpassed their very own 143-run partnership in 2019. Additionally it is the very best opening stand in Ladies’s T20Is involving full‑member groups.
Quickest to 10,000 worldwide runs
Mandhana grew to become the quickest batter in ladies’s cricket to succeed in 10,000 runs, attaining the mark in her 280th match and overtaking earlier file‑holders Mithali Raj, Suzie Bates and Charlotte Edwards. She is barely the second Indian, after Raj, to succeed in the milestone.
Third consecutive fifty for Verma
Shafali recorded her third straight half‑century within the sequence.
Sequence and calendar context
India sealed a 4‑0 lead with one match to play. Sri Lanka’s 191/6 was their highest Ladies’s T20I rating.

Turning factors & tactical choices
India’s openers exploited the fielding restrictions, plundering 61 runs within the first six overs. The brand new-ball bowlers of Sri Lanka, Kawya Kavindi and Kavisha Dilhari, bowled 47 runs of their 4 overs mixed.
Spin strangulation
Vaishnavi Sharma rolled 9 dot balls throughout the spell and despatched Athapaththu again when Sri Lanka was about to strike. This wicket had slackened the pursuit and turned the tide.
Richa Ghosh’s cameo
Promoted above Harleen Deol, Ghosh smashed 40* off 16 balls, including 53 runs with Harmanpreet and making certain a goal past Sri Lanka’s attain.
India misplaced a number of catches and a stumping; the weaknesses stored Sri Lanka longer within the recreation and will likely be a fear earlier than the ultimate recreation of the sequence.
What the consequence means
The win provides India an unassailable 4–0 lead heading into the fifth and closing T20I on 30 December 2025. The dominant batting efficiency underlines India’s preparation for the ICC Ladies’s T20 World Cup 2026; they’ve posted totals of 217/4, 210/5 and now 221/2 within the final 18 months.
Mandhana’s world file underscores her standing among the many greats, whereas Verma’s consistency and Ghosh’s ending augur effectively for India’s batting depth. For Sri Lanka, the improved batting show and the very best T20I rating provide encouragement, however their bowling and demise‑over execution require enchancment.
Quotes & reactions
Smriti Mandhana, Participant of the Match: “After taking part in a whole lot of ODI cricket this 12 months, it was robust to get into T20 mode…right now the plan was related however execution was higher. Moreover, watching Shafali bat is a deal with; she does the majority of the hitting within the powerplay. Within the final 12 months, everybody within the crew is celebrating one another’s success.”
Harmanpreet Kaur, India captain: “We thought we’d give Harleen an opportunity, however Smriti and Shafali batted so effectively that we needed to ship Richa to complete. Our fielding wants work, we had been quick on time and I didn’t need penalties.”
Chamari Athapaththu, Sri Lanka captain: “We improved in our batting however nonetheless must work on energy‑hitting. India batted very well and Vaishnavi is bowling effectively; she bowls based on plan.”
What’s subsequent
The fifth and closing T20I will likely be performed on the similar venue on 30 December 2025. As well as, India will look to finish a 5–0 whitewash and fine-tune their fielding, whereas Sri Lanka will purpose for a comfort win and to hold their improved batting kind into future assignments.
